Dear Supporter,

I would like thank everyone who helped in my campaign and voted Labour in the Ealing Southall Parliamentary election on the 6th May. I am deeply honoured to have been re-elected to serve all the people of Ealing Southall in Parliament irrespective of how they voted.

I will roll up my sleeves and work hard on behalf of every individual and all communities in the constituency, helping build a united community. I will continue to run my office in the constituency and hold regular weekly advice surgeries and prioritise those issues that are important to local people.  

I will campaign to protect acute services at Ealing Hospital, oppose the Southall gasworks development and Heathrow expansion, work to ensure Crossrail goes ahead, work in partnership with the new Labour Council and seek to protect and improve frontline public services in the difficult current financial circumstances.

It is a big challenge but I am grateful to the people of Ealing Southall for giving me the opportunity to continue to tackle it.

Virendra Sharma

Labour MP for Ealing Southall

The Result

Ealing Southall

6 May 2010

Elected: Sharma, Virendra Kumar (Lab)
Turnout: 64.67%
Electorate: 66,970

Name of candidate

Description

Number of votes

ANIL Mehboob

The Christian Party

503

BAKHAI Nigel

Liberal Democrat

6383

BASU Suneil

Green Party

705

CHAGGAR Sati

English Democrats -"Putting England First!"

408

SHARMA Virendra Kumar

The Labour Party Candidate

22,024 elected

SINGH Gurcharan

The Conservative Party Candidate

12,733
